New Information Regarding Arrest of Sought-After Suspect


                            


KOSCIUSKO COUNTY, Ind. (WOWO): Kosciusko County officers have located and arrested a suspect being sought-after following a meth-lab investigation.


Warsaw Police Narcotics and Kosciusko County Drug Task Force officers arrested 48-year-old Richard Lattea, of Milford, on preliminary charges of felony dealing methamphetamine.


Lattea’s arrest stemmed from a January 14th investigation at 9265 North, Old State Road 15, in Milford. Lattea had left the residence prior to officers arriving on the scene, but tips to his whereabouts eventually led to his arrest on Friday, January 16th.


Lattea is currently being held in the Kosciusko County Jail on a $7,500 bond.
